				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.toonaripost.com">The Toonari Post - News, Powered by the People!</a></p><p>On October 4, tens of thousands of citizens gathered in Seoul Plaza, Korea, to enjoy Korean singer Psy’s concert.</p>
<p>The chubby 34-year-old rapper, who recently became a global sensation with his song ‘Gangnam Style,’ held the concert for free in return for fans’ support.</p>
<p>According to Korean police authorities, about 80,000 citizens gathered, and it was the first time that the massive plaza was packed with this many people. His concert was also aired on YouTube, but many people had trouble with watching it because of too many simultaneous log-ins.</p>
<p>17-year-old student Huh Seung-ah said, “Usually, the concert ticket for a famous singer is really expensive. But, today, Psy is holding the concert for free! I didn’t want to miss this chance.”</p>
<p>Not only teenagers, but also middle-aged citizens attended Psy’s concert. 43-year-old house wife Kim Ji-hee said, “I see Psy’s news on TV every day. I wanted to see how fun his concert is.”</p>
<p>Foreign fans were also spotted. 24-year-old Valentina from Chile said, “I came to Korea to enjoy the Korean singer’s music, and today I’m so happy that I can enjoy Psy’s concert for free.”</p>
<p>The concert, which started around 10 pm, kicked off with Psy’s song “Right Now,” and reached the climax when Psy sang “Gangnam Style.”</p>
<p>Around 11:30 pm, Psy showed up with a bottle of soju, saying, “I promised that I will not drink on the stage, but, today, I’m so happy that I feel like I should drink.” He emptied the bottle after shouting, “Korea! Hooray!”</p>
<p>When 11:40 pm came, he took off his shirt and danced topless to “Gangnam Style.” He once said he would dance topless if he tops the Billboard Hot 100. Even though his song remains on second place of the chart as of October 5, he performed topless as he promised.</p>
<p>Because of the concert, the traffic of Seoul was controlled and guided by the police authorities from 6pm to midnight. Hotels and stores located around Seoul Plaza benefited from Psy’s concert.</p>
<p>Seoul Plaza Hotel, which is standing right next to Seoul Plaza, was all booked by people who wanted to watch Psy’s concert in the hotel. According to the hotel, some customers asked the hotel to change their room to higher floor to enjoy the concert.”</p>
<p>Convenience stores around the plaza also witnessed their sales volume increase. A part-time worker at Seven Eleven said, “Thanks to Psy’s concert, the number of customers was doubled.”</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.toonaripost.com">The Toonari Post - News, Powered by the People!</a></p><p>PSY’s Gangnam Style has jumped to the 64th spot on the Billboard Hot 100 chart, now the best-selling record among Korean pop singers.</p>
<p>In 2009, the Korean girl band “Wonder Girls” reached the 76th spot of this chart with their song “Nobody,” and was at the time the highest grossing record any Korean singer had had in the U.S. market.</p>
<p>With his appearance on U.S. television and radio programs, on top of several promotion events with his new agent Scooter Braun, it is expected that his popularity will keep gaining momentum. Braun is also responsible for making Justin Bieber a super star. The number of YouTube views of PSY&#8217;s music video is still increasing, having reached 160 million views and holding great promise for his future success in the U.S.</p>
<p>PSY&#8217;s Gangnam Style is doing a great on the iTunes Music Chart as well. According to the single chart of iTunes, ‘Top Songs,’ Gangnam Style is staying at 6th place as of September 13.</p>
<p>PSY was invited to the MTV awards to celebrate 100 million YouTube views of his music video, making many American shows interested in inviting him to their show. He was on <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=QZmkU5Pg1sw&amp;feature=share" target="_blank">The Ellen DeGeneres Show</a> on September 11, teaching his “Horse dance” to Ellen and the other guest Britney Spears. It is reported that the show got its highest viewer ratings since 2003. PSY will be on the show again in the near future as a guest and will talk about himself with Ellen. It is reported that NBC&#8217;s Today Show is also planning to invite him as a guest.</p>
<p>The number of parody videos of the Gangnam Style music video is increasing. Currently, videos of the <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=QTMRPs8LUkg" target="_blank">Obama version</a> of Gangnam Style and the <a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=RsN74td3VmA" target="_blank">Romney version</a> are gaining popularity online. In the Obama version, clips of Obama&#8217;s speeches are used to make up the song, and it looks like Obama is singing the Gangnam Style song. Meanwhile, NBC’s The Tonight Show with Jay Leno aired a parody video by using computer graphic that made Romney dance to Gangnam Style.</p>
<p>ABC news reported on Night Line that Gangnam Style’s humor, sarcasm and addictive beat are the key of PSY&#8217;s success.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.toonaripost.com">The Toonari Post - News, Powered by the People!</a></p><p>South Korea’s famous K-Pop star Psy, or Park Jae-sang, is grabbing the most attention in the U.S. with his latest song ‘Gangnam Style.’</p>
<p>His music video for &#8220;Gangnam Style&#8221; has already attracted about 59 million YouTube views, and stays at the number one spot on not only Billboard&#8217;s K-Pop charts, but also other Korean local music charts. The music video was introduced to viewers worldwide by global media such as CNN, ABC, LA TIMES, and the Wall Street Journal.</p>
<p>Psy recently visited the U.S., was on the U.S. TV show ‘Big Morning Buzz Live,’ on August 22, introducing his song to American viewers.</p>
<p>“Gangnam is an affluent area just like Beverly Hills in the state. But the funny part of my song is that a funny-looking guy like me is talking about Gangnam style in the song, because I don’t look like a guy from Gangnam,” said Psy on the show.</p>
<p>Psy taught his dance, the so-called horse dance, to the show hosts, making them laugh and excited.</p>
<p>The 36-year-old hip-hop singer, who graduated Berkelee college of music in Boston, debuted in 2001, winning huge popularity with his single ‘Bird’.</p>
<p>However, it did not take long for him to lose his fame and stand point.</p>
<p>His life has been just like a roller coaster over the past 12 years. He was convicted of smoking marijuana in the early 2000s. He was even accused of not properly fulfilling his alternative military service (In South Korea, men over the age of 18, need to fulfill their mandatory military service for two years), having the biggest crisis in his career and life in 2007.</p>
<p>Following several months of investigation by the prosecution, it turned out that Psy was neglecting his military duty, and he was ordered to serve the full two-year national service again in July 2007.</p>
<p>Because of all of these unfavorable factors for Psy, it seems that he has been gradually forgotten from the public’s memory. However, nothing could eliminate his passion toward music. He continues his music career by writing songs for other singers in Korea and holding concerts for his fans. His success with his latest song is not surprising.</p>
<p>It is reported that Psy has earned about ten billion won (about eight million dollars) so far with the song ‘Gangnam Style.’ He even was contacted by Justin Biber’s agency and flew to the U.S. to meet with him, implying that he might start his music career in the U.S. in the near future.</p>
